• COBOLは社会保障省の主要なコンポーネントであり、60億行以上のコードを維持
  • COBOLの特異性は日付の保存や操作方法の標準化が欠けている
  • 1875年5月20日はISO 8601の基準で時間と日付の始まりとされ、代替情報のプレースホルダーとして使用される
  • 社会保障の記録にはエラーが多く、年配の人々のデータには整合性がない
  • 社会保障省は自動システムを導入して115歳以上の支払いをブロック
  • 政府の多くのシステムはCOBOLを使用し、更新の資金不足が課題

COBOLは長年使われてきたが、データ処理や信頼性に優れるため、まだ有用性がある。古いコードを更新するための資金不足が政府の課題であり、COBOLコードの大量の近代化が困難である。

元記事: https://www.zdnet.com/article/if-cobol-is-so-problematic-why-does-the-us-government-still-use-it/